Stimulant
A type of drug that increases activity of the central nervous system, resulting in increased alertness, attention, and energy.
Opioids
Substances, including morphine and heroin, that produce euphoria followed by a tranquil state; in severe intoxication, can lead to unconsciousness, coma, and seizures; can cause withdrawal symptoms of emotional distress, severe nausea, sweating, diarrhea, and fever.
